What institutional barriers are keeping life scientists from communicating to the public about their work? Leaders from the life sciences community and from research organizations explored the current landscape of public communication of the life sciences. The workshop addressed many challenges life scientists face, policy restrictions in government, incentives and adequate support structures at the university level, and intellectual property issues in industry. Participants also highlighted new opportunities and models of communications. The workshop concluded with discussions about the funding landscape for life scientist communicators and the building blocks needed to develop sustainable infrastructures for life science communication.
